Description
- Terence Koh
- Zhang ZYI Buddha Fly Earth (The Earthly Dragon)
- plaster, clay, wood, enamel, spray paint, paraffin, beeswax, artist's blood and Chanel lipstick
- 155 by 27 by 27 cm.; 61 by 10 5/8 by 10 5/8 in.
- Executed in 2006.
Provenance
Peres Project, Berlin
Acquired directly from the above by the present owner
Exhibited
New York, Asia Song Society, Terence Koh: Buddha Fly Earth, 2006
Wolverhampton, Initial Access, Time Difference, 2008

Condition
Colour: The colours in the catalogue illustration are fairly accurate, although the overall tonality is deeper and richer, with the red tending more towards scarlet in the original.
Condition: This work is in very good condition. A few dust fibres have collected in the crevaces of the wax throughout. There are two light unobtrusive rub marks to the left side of the bottom of the base.
